Aston Villa vs Preston Predictions

Aston Villa remain under pressure, and they face a must win encounter with Preston on Tuesday night. The Villains slipped up again at the weekend, so Steve Bruce needs a big display from his players. However, they’re not under quite as much pressure as Preston, who have fallen from seventh down to bottom of the Championship. These two were fairly close last season, with the visitors finishing a point shy of the top six, while Villa were runners-up in the play-offs. Neither side are matching that so far, but can the hosts leap up the table?

The tight nature of the Championship makes problems quickly turn to a crisis. Villa have fallen to 15th in the standings, which is a mighty slump for a side of their calibre. However, they’re still just two points off the top six. They could easily storm back in to play-off contention by the end of the weekend. Meetings with the bottom two come in the next few days, so Bruce has a crucial couple of clashes coming up. Can they start with three points at home to the basement side this week?

Preston have been in alarmingly bad form of late. they lost 3-2 at home to West Brom on Saturday, which put the Baggies six points clear of Villa, and top of the table. Defensively Preston have been dreadful, shipping three goals in each of their last four league games. That’s a concern going in to this meeting with Villa, who have started to click going forward with two players in attack. Will this be yet another loss for the bottom side?

Villa have some issues themselves, with one win in nine. However, they’ve been given the best possible chance to break that run. They are capable going forward at their own ground, and they meet a Preston side who are looking dreadful. The visitors are pointless on the road after losing all five of their away trips, the latest of which saw them beaten 3-2 by Sheffield United. They’ve shipped 10 goals in their last four away trips, having scored only two on the road all season.
